Liquid xenon can be used as a scintillator for time-of-flight positron emission tomography (TOF-PFT) owing to its fast responses and high scintillation yield. For confirmation, a prototype model was constructed and tested. The results were better than those obtained with commercially available crystal PET scanners, except energy resolution Was Slightly worse than with a GSO crystal PET. Using the results and simulations, a full-size liquid xenon scintillation TOF-PET scanner was designed and its possible realization discussed. (c) 2006 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
